2-Inch Net Pots are a versatile hydroponic growing container designed to support seedlings, cuttings, and small plants in a wide variety of soilless growing systems. The slotted mesh design allows plant roots to grow freely through the sides and bottom of the pot, improving oxygen exposure and allowing nutrient-rich water to reach the root zone.

Commonly used in NFT hydroponic systems, propagation trays, aquaponics setups, and cloning systems, these net cups securely hold growing media such as rockwool, clay pellets, coco coir, or perlite while providing excellent drainage and airflow for healthy root development.

Their compact 2-inch size makes them ideal for starting leafy greens, herbs, strawberries, and other hydroponic crops while fitting easily into standard hydroponic and propagation setups.

Key Features

  • Promotes Healthy Root Growth
    The open mesh design allows roots to extend through the pot, improving oxygen availability and encouraging strong root development.

  • Excellent Drainage & Aeration
    Slotted sides and bottom allow water and nutrients to flow freely through the growing media while preventing waterlogging.

  • Compatible with Multiple Growing Media
    Works with common hydroponic substrates including rockwool cubes, expanded clay pellets (Hydroton), coco coir, perlite and foam collars.

  • Versatile Hydroponic Applications
    Suitable for use in NFT systems, deep water culture (DWC), aeroponics, aquaponics and drip irrigation systems.

  • Reusable & Durable
    Constructed from sturdy plastic designed for repeated use across multiple growing cycles.

This is a beautiful tome of the first issues of Superman under Action Comics and the first Superman issue. Although providing the same texts of Chronicles, I find this series better because they have more issues per volume. In spite of its 390 pages, these volumes are light and easy to handle. Albeit the simplicity and innocence of these stories, Superman impresses me as a "dark knight" of the skies given his toughness with the bad guys. In these stories, he's got no compassion for criminals. He also defends the working class, stand for fair treatment of workers, and even takes an "isolationist" stance which was popular in the days before WWII. Another surprise for the first-time reader of this period is that Superman can't fly; he can only leap over tall buildings. There is no Krypton and no Daily Planet. The city of Metropolis is introduced for the first time in the second half of this tome. And Lois Lane is often relegated to unimportant journalistic tasks, while she has greater ambitions. It is a great experience to read these old stories in a beautifully designed tome. I hope they reproduce the others quickly.

I've been a fan for as long as I've been able to tie a bath towel around my neck, so diving into these early comics has been a real joy! The character was quite different in the beginning so if you're not familiar with Golden Age Superman this might be quite the eye opener. Here in these early comics, Supes certainly isn't the Big Blue Boy Scout you knew and loved in the Silver Age and beyond; early on, he's more like the Well-Meaning Big Blue Bully/Borderline Sociopath. Sort of like early Golden Age Batman: bad guys die, Superman (or Batman) kind of shrugs and thinks, "Well, they got what they deserved..." His relationship with Lois is a bit more desperate-seeming in a few places as well. In fact, he's almost a bit stalker-ish in his pursuit/attitude toward Miss Lane. You can thank DC editor Whitney Ellsworth and a few others for softening the rough edges and turning The Man of Steel into the virtuous character we have today.
